The Federal Home Loan Bank of Pittsburgh (FHLBank), in conjunction with its housing finance agency partners, announced that $8.4 million in Home4Good grants have been awarded this year to support 110 programs in Delaware, Pennsylvania and West Virginia.

The U.S. Plastics Pact (USPP) today released its first-ever policy position paper on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R), offering a clear, consensus-built framework to guide policymakers as states consider EPR legislation for plastic packaging. Today, Warren E. Buffett converted 1,800 A shares into 2,700,000 B shares in order to give these B shares to four family foundations: 1,500,000 shares to The Susan Thompson Buffett Foundation and 400,000 shares to each of The Sherwood Foundation, The Howard G. Buffett Foundation and NoVo Foundation. Newmont Corporation (NYSE: NEM, TSX: NGT, ASX: NEM, PNGX: NEM) (“Newmont”) has announced an CAD $8 million community investment to benefit the Tahltan Nation as part of its celebration of the tenth anniversary of the Red Chris Mine.
